Randal Lynn Buck, 67, Johnson City, passed away Wednesday, September 11, 2024 in the Johnson City Medical Center.. He was born July 20, 1957 in Elizabethton.  Randal was a graduate of Happy Valley High School. In earlier years, he was employed by the Carter County Sheriff Department, Unicoi County Sheriff Department where he was a Sgt. and also the Erwin Police Department. Randal also had worked at Nuclear Fuel.  He was an avid hunter and fisherman. He was preceded in death by a brother: Todd Buck.
